Day off work so get some bits on for the bike rack, a box arrived from the States with hitch, tow ball and nice little locking pin. 5 mins later, looks like my measurements weren't too far out ! Whistle
Rack is a Thule Euro 929. 3 bikes will fit or 4 with the extension rack. I think the receiver might rattle a bit in the square tube, so might need a clamp pin, we'll see at the weekend.
2 mins to remove rack and hitch when not in use.



Click image to enlarge



Click image to enlarge



Enough clearance to open the door nearly all the way, phew.

Another update
Also got the best looking spare wheel lock on the market, decided to make some little spacer tubes rather than the 6 washers that the instructions suggested, to get the correct gap. Slim bit of foam on the back of the large washer to keep things from rubbing and rattle free, and all looks fine. Took ages to fine tune, to get it sitting exactly horizontal, as any angle is really obvious. Smile
